Activating Wi-Fi Mode

Activating Wi-Fi mode on your smart oven is a crucial step to enable remote control and connectivity. First, confirm your oven is powered on and not in active use. Locate the Wi-Fi or Remote Enable button on the control panel—this varies by model. Press and hold this button for at least three seconds until you see a flashing Wi-Fi icon or specific indicator light confirming pairing mode. Some models may display a message or message on the control screen. For ovens with a knob, turn it to the “Remote Enable” position, or follow model-specific instructions. Once Wi-Fi mode is active, your oven is ready to connect to the app. Keep your smartphone nearby to complete the pairing process smoothly. Verifying the Pairing Process and Entering Security Details

verify codes enter password

During the pairing process, verifying that the appliance and app are communicating correctly by confirming the numerical code displayed on the oven matches the one shown in the app is vital. This step ensures you’re connecting to the right device and prevents security issues. Once the codes match, you’ll be prompted to enter your Wi-Fi network password. Make sure your password is correct and compatible with your oven’s requirements. After entering the password, both the app and oven will ask for dual confirmation to finalize the connection. Pay attention to any security prompts or additional instructions specific to your model. Confirming these details guarantees a secure, stable connection, setting the foundation for seamless remote control of your smart oven.

Following Model-Specific Instructions for Successful Connection

follow brand specific setup steps

Different smart oven brands have unique steps you need to follow to guarantee a successful connection. For example, GE ovens require turning the control knob to “Remote Enable” with the temperature knob at “Off” before pairing. LG ThinQ models often need the Wi-Fi icon or LED light to be blinking, indicating they’re ready to connect. Whirlpool appliances display a message on the LCD, saying, “Use the App to set up Wi-Fi,” signaling it’s time to proceed. Café Appliances with knob controls need you to press the “Push to Enter” knob until the Wi-Fi icon flashes. Samsung ranges may require different commands, like pressing “START” or “Send to Oven,” depending on whether they’re electric or gas. Following these specific instructions guarantees your connection is smooth and dependable.

Frequently Asked Questions

Can I Pair My Smart Oven Without Internet Access?

Yes, you can pair your smart oven without internet access. You’ll need to enable Bluetooth or Wi-Fi Direct mode on the oven, then open the app and follow the pairing instructions. Make sure your phone’s Bluetooth and Location Services are on, and stay close to the oven during setup. You may not access remote control features, but initial pairing and basic controls should work offline.

What Should I Do if the App Doesn’T Detect My Oven?

If the app doesn’t detect your oven, first make certain the oven is in pairing mode—check for indicator lights or messages. Move closer to the appliance within 3-5 feet, and restart the app. Turn off and on your oven to reset the connection, and verify Bluetooth and Wi-Fi are enabled on your device. If it still doesn’t work, restart your phone, update the app, or consult the user manual for additional troubleshooting steps.
